The Science Behind Water Heater Scale Formation
While most homeowners focus on the visible effects of hard water, such as soap scum and spotted dishes, the most damaging impact occurs hidden inside your water heater.
Here's what's happening: hard water contains elevated levels of calcium and magnesium ions that transform into troublesome deposits when heated.
As your water heater operates, these minerals undergo a chemical reaction. The calcium carbonate becomes less soluble at higher temperatures, precipitating out of solution and adhering to heating elements and tank walls.
This creates a barrier between the heating element and the water it's trying to warm.
The consequences are significant—scale-covered heaters require 27% more energy to function properly.
This mineral buildup not only drives up your utility bills but systematically shortens your appliance's lifespan through reduced efficiency and eventual component failure.
How Water Softeners Combat Mineral Buildup
When you've struggled with crusty faucets and inefficient appliances, water softeners offer a powerful solution to your hard water problems.
They employ ion exchange technology to swap calcium and magnesium minerals with sodium or potassium ions, effectively preventing scale buildup in your water heater.

Real-World Evidence of Scale Reduction
The theoretical benefits of water softening are compelling, but what happens in real homes with real water heaters?
Case studies consistently demonstrate that softened water delivers measurable results. Homeowners report noticeable efficiency improvements within just 1-6 months after installation, while complete descaling often occurs within 6-24 months.
The impact is substantial—heating systems using softened water consume 27% less energy than those struggling with hard water deposits.
This descaling process works most effectively in systems with warmer temperatures and consistent water circulation, which enhance calcium carbonate solubility.
When softened water flows through existing systems, it gradually dissolves accumulated scale without harsh chemicals or mechanical intervention.
Most importantly, once the system is clean, the softened water prevents new deposits from forming, creating a self-maintaining environment that extends equipment life and reduces maintenance costs.
